Subject: [PATCH 3/6] crypto: ccp: Move some PSP mailbox bit definitions into common header
Date: Thu, 9 Feb 2023 16:38:05 -0600 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20230209223811.4993-4-mario.limonciello@amd.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20230209223811.4993-1-mario.limonciello@amd.com>
Some of the bits and fields used for mailboxes communicating with the
PSP are common across all mailbox implementations (SEV, TEE, etc).
Move these bits into the common `linux/psp.h` so they don't need to
be re-defined for each implementation.

diff --git a/include/linux/psp.h b/include/linux/psp.h
index 202162487ec3b..d3424790a70eb 100644
--- a/include/linux/psp.h
+++ b/include/linux/psp.h
@@ -11,4 +11,16 @@
#define __psp_pa(x) __pa(x)
#endif
+/*
+ * Fields and bits used by most PSP mailboxes
+ *
+ * Note: Some mailboxes (such as SEV) have extra bits or different meanings
+ * and should include an appropriate local definition in their source file.
+ */
+#define PSP_CMDRESP_STS GENMASK(15, 0)
+#define PSP_CMDRESP_CMD GENMASK(23, 16)
+#define PSP_CMDRESP_RESERVED GENMASK(29, 24)
+#define PSP_CMDRESP_RECOVERY BIT(30)
+#define PSP_CMDRESP_RESP BIT(31)
+
#endif /* __PSP_H */
